    Fresh leak hints at Galaxy S27 Pro and Ultra camera system

    Sources close to the matter claim that Samsung’s upcoming flagships, the Galaxy S27 Pro and Galaxy S27 Ultra, will share the same new main and ultra-wide sensors. The smaller S27 Pro, rumored to feature a 6.5-inch display, is said to borrow the Ultra’s high-end primary and ultra-wide cameras, while the telephoto setup could be the deciding factor for many buyers. The write-up suggests the telephoto part may define the differences between the two models, with pricing and availability still unconfirmed.

    Telephoto and zoom details for the S27 lineup

    The Galaxy S27 Ultra is projected to keep a 5x periscope zoom camera paired with a 10x in-sensor crop, which would be a continuation of Samsung’s emphasis on strong zoom performance. It is possible the S27 Pro might land a 3-4x zoom alternative, though there’s still speculation that Samsung could offer a more affordable 5x zoom sensor in the smaller model. This is a key point that could influence consumer choice once specs officially drop.

    Camera overhaul and sensor upgrade across models

    In a notable shift, the Ultra’s camera array is expected to drop the dedicated 3x telephoto lens in favor of in-sensor cropping within a streamlined triple-camera arrangement. A new primary 200MP sensor, likely the 1/1.3-inch ISOCELL HP6, is said to be used, and this sensor configuration might also appear in the S27 Pro, signaling a unified high-end imaging strategy across the two devices.

    Display sizes and exclusive features

    Aside from camera advances, the two devices are projected to remain largely the same in overall design, with the main practical difference being the S Pen’s exclusivity to the larger Galaxy S27 Ultra. The S27 Pro is expected to maintain a 6.5-inch display, while the Ultra is anticipated to measure about 6.9 inches, potentially influencing ergonomics and user experience for stylus users and media consumers alike.     Samsung has yet to replace the Galaxy S25 Ultra, which is currently priced at $1,019 on Amazon. According to recent leaks, the company is expected to unveil the Galaxy S26 Ultra along with more affordable flagships on February 25. However, the leaker Ice Universe claims to have obtained important details about the rumored Galaxy S27 Ultra.

    Camera Upgrades Imminent

    Not long ago, the same leaker hinted that Samsung intends to make significant camera improvements with the upcoming model. In short, Ice Universe shared that the Galaxy S27 Ultra will have revamped primary, front-facing, and ultra-wide-angle cameras compared to those in the Galaxy S26 Ultra.

    New Sensor Details

    Writing on X, Ice Universe has now indicated that Samsung will use the ISOCELL HP6 for the Galaxy S27 Ultra. While the specifics of other camera upgrades are still unclear, the leaker asserts that the new sensor maintains the same size as the ISOCELL HP2 found in recent Galaxy S Ultra models.

    The ISOCELL HP6 is expected to offer a 1/1.3-inch optical format. This means that Samsung will probably not incorporate a 1-inch style primary camera in the near future, similar to what current Xiaomi and Oppo Ultra-branded flagships have. It seems that other “new technologies” will also be integrated into the ISOCELL HP6, although details about these advancements may take time to surface.
